¿Qué es Venison Sirloin?
A lean cut of meat from the hindquarter of various deer species, known for its rich, gamey flavor and tender texture when properly cooked.

Per 112g (4 oz)El Secreto del Chef
Marinate venison in red wine with juniper berries and herbs for at least 4 hours to tenderize and enhance its rich flavor, then sear quickly to medium-rare.
Sustitutos y Proporciones de Venison Sirloin
El mejor sustituto para Venison Sirloin es Beef Sirloin, usado en una proporción de 1:1. Closest in cut and cooking method, but less gamey flavor.
| Sustituto | Proporción | Mejor para |
|---|---|---|
| Beef Sirloin Mejor | 1:1 | Closest in cut and cooking method, but less gamey flavor. |
| Lamb Loin | 1:1 | Offers a distinct, slightly gamey flavor profile, similar tenderness. |
| Bison Steak | 1:1 | Very lean red meat with an earthy flavor, similar to venison but milder. |
| Pork Loin | 1:1 | Lean cut, but milder flavor and less gamey, requires different seasoning. |
